Different Heel Branding Appears On The Air Force 1 Low “Phantom/Black”

The Nike Air Force 1 is obviously no stranger to unique color palettes and materials, but at the same time, we’ve also seen the Beaverton brand change up its branding to produce fresh takes on the Bruce Kilgore classic.

This “Phantom/Black” pair for women is best described as a lesson in contrast, but its most notable elements have nothing to do with the black and white color blocking. Breaking from tradition, an oversized, white-on-white Swoosh appears over “Air” lettering on the heel, while stenciled-out Nike text hits the insoles. The tongue tag logo remains unchanged, although it’s nearly invisible in black-on-black to match the quarter Swoosh and sole.

Pairs are currently available overseas, signaling that a stateside drop is likely to follow in the near future. For now, enjoy official images of the AF1 Low “Phantom/Black” below and tap our Sneaker Release Dates page to preview more upcoming drops from the Swoosh.
